I think Swampert is cute, and it's a very good Pokémon defensive-wise. I believe it and Blaziken are nearly total opposites in terms of stats.
Swampert is bulky, and can take some hits while setting up hazards or boosting its stats to sweep.
Blaziken is faster, hits harder without needing to set up, but its defenses are lower so it's more fragile.
Whatever suits your playing style, both are great Pokémon. Of course, I prefer Blaziken. ;)

I would have said Swampert if you weren't just going through your game with a single Pokemon. Blaziken is better for that everywhere except against Tate and Liza. Being faster than Swampert makes it better for a solo challenge.
 
Both Pokemon are freaking amazing. Either one would be a good choice, however I voted Blaziken because it's fire and fighting make the elite four a breeze, just make sure you get an electric or grass pokemon for the champion.
